In 1933, the 21st amendment was ratified and the 18th amendment was repealed. Our nation could finally enjoy legal libations again, and the high costs of enforcing Prohibition could finally be left in the past. However, the celebration that settled over our nation in 1933 is something that shouldn’t be forgotten. At 1933 Lounge, a speakeasy in Indiana continues to thrive to this very day… at least in spirit. 1933 Lounge has two locations: one in Indianapolis and one in Fishers.
When the St. Elmo's location opened, visitors were stunned by the beauty of its restored bar from the late 1800s. That same homey atmosphere was echoed throughout the rest of the atmosphere.

The Fishers location is a great spot for a meal, as it features a full lunch and dinner menu.
Their shrimp cocktail is a fan favorite, but it's one of several selections that'll have your taste buds begging for more. King crab mac and cheese is a must, and their spinach dip is to die for.
If Indiana enjoys a mild winter, this patio may be enjoyed nearly all year round. However, it's downright magical in the summer months when a gentle breeze is stirring up the aromas of delicious food.
...And the bar at each location is oh so welcoming.
Can you imagine yourself enjoying an Elmo Cola here? (For the uninitiated, that's a Coke with Maker’s Mark bourbon, vanilla, and cherries.) The cocktail list here is inventive and unique, offering both familiar favorites like Mules, and more unique flavors like their Liquid Love Affair.
